区块链合约方式详解:理解智能合约及其应用

                  发布时间:2024-12-16 05:26:54

                  在数字经济快速发展的时代,区块链技术逐渐成为一种重要的基础设施,其中的智能合约更是备受关注。智能合约的出现,不仅提高了合同的执行效率,还增强了透明度和安全性。本文将围绕“区块链合约方式”这一主题展开,以深入解析智能合约的概念、技术背景、应用场景以及其可能引发的相关问题。

                  一、区块链合约方式的定义

                  区块链合约,通常称为智能合约,是运行在区块链上自动执行的合约。不同于传统的合同,智能合约利用区块链的智能机制,通过代码的编写在特定条件满足时自动执行相关指令,从而实现合同履行的自动化。区块链合约的真正魅力在于其不可篡改性、自动化执行、以及去中心化的特点,这些特性使得智能合约在许多领域都具有广泛的应用潜力。

                  二、智能合约的工作原理

                  智能合约的运行依赖于区块链技术的支持,其基本工作原理可以分为以下几个步骤:

                  1. **合约编写**:开发者使用编程语言(例如Solidity)编写合约代码,定义合同的条款和条件。

                  2. **合约部署**:将智能合约上传并部署到区块链网络,合约会获得一个唯一的地址。

                  3. **触发执行**:一旦满足特定条件,合约会自动执行相应的指令,例如转账或提供服务。

                  4. **结果记录**:所有的执行结果会被记录在区块链上,保障其不可篡改性和透明性。

                  三、智能合约的应用场景

                  智能合约具有广泛的应用场景,以下是几个主要领域的具体介绍:

                  1. **金融服务**:在金融行业,智能合约可以应用于自动化的贷款、保险及证券的交易,提高交易效率,降低成本。

                  2. **供应链管理**:智能合约可以通过跟踪商品在供应链中的所有环节,确保交易的透明度,减少欺诈风险。

                  3. **房地产交易**:通过智能合约,可以实现房地产交易的自动化,包括产权转移和交易资金的自动释放,保障交易双方的利益。

                  4. **数字身份验证**:智能合约可以用于创建和管理数字身份,使个人在网上的身份信息得到安全管理,有效防止身份盗用。

                  四、智能合约的优势

                  智能合约相较于传统合约,具有明显的优势:

                  1. **提高效率**:智能合约通过自动化执行合同条款,消除了人工干预的需求,大大提高了处理速度。

                  2. **降低成本**:去中心化的特性使得中介机构的需求减少,从而降低了交易成本。

                  3. **增强安全性**:由于智能合约运行在区块链上,其数据被多方验证及备份,具有较强的抗篡改能力,确保合同的安全。

                  4. **提高透明度**:所有的交易记录都会在区块链上公开,减少了信息不对称的问题,增加了交易的透明度。

                  五、智能合约的挑战

                  尽管智能合约具有众多优势,但在实际应用过程中也面临一些挑战:

                  1. **法律认知**:很多国家和地区对智能合约的法律地位和条款还缺乏明确的界定,可能导致合同的执行过程出现法律争议。

                  2. **代码安全性**:智能合约采用编程代码,若代码出现漏洞,可能被恶意攻击者利用,导致资产损失。

                  3. **可扩展性问题**:随着交易量的增加,现有区块链网络的可扩展性可能成为瓶颈,影响智能合约的有效执行。

                  4. **用户教育**:对于普通用户而言,理解和使用智能合约仍有一定的门槛,需要进行大量的教育和推广。

                  六、常见问题解答

                  1. 什么是智能合约的法律效力?

                  智能合约的法律效力是一个复杂的问题,目前大多数法域尚未对其进行明确界定。在一些国家,例如新加坡和以色列,智能合约被法律承认并具备法律效力;而在其他一些法域,智能合约的法律地位尚不明确。企业在实施智能合约前应咨询法律专业人士,以确保合约的可执行性。

                  2. 如何确保智能合约的安全性?

                  确保智能合约的安全性主要有三个方面:一是对合约代码进行全面审计,确保无漏洞;二是使用成熟的开发框架和工具,利用社区智慧加快安全性提高的速度;三是在合约部署后进行压力测试,以检验其在高负载下的表现、稳定性和安全性。

                  3. 智能合约在不同业务领域的成功案例有哪些?

                  在金融领域,Compound等去中心化金融平台通过智能合约实现了无需信任的贷款和借贷;在供应链管理方面,IBM的Food Trust项目通过智能合约追踪食品来源,保障安全;在房地产方面,Propy利用智能合约进行房地产交易,实现快速而安全的交易流程。这些案例为智能合约在各项业务中的应用提供了有力的支持。

                  4. 智能合约是否能替代传统合同?

                  智能合约在很多领域能有效提升效率和安全性,但不一定能完全替代传统合同。对复杂交易、涉及多个法律条款的合约,传统合同仍然占据主导地位。此外,智能合约的法律地位在多个地区尚未明确,进一步影响合同的有效执行。因此,两者可以根据情况结合使用以发挥各自的优势。

                  5. 如何开始开发智能合约?

                  开发智能合约通常需要具备一定的编程基础和对区块链技术的理解。开发者可以选择流行的区块链平台,如以太坊,阅读相关文档进行学习;可参加在线课程,或观看视频教程;也可以加入开发者社区进行交流和学习,最终开始自己的智能合约项目。

                  6. 为什么智能合约在未来的发展中备受追捧?

                  智能合约被认为是未来的趋势,主要因为其带来的高效率、低成本和高透明度等优势。此外,全球范围内对数字化和自动化的需求日益增强,智能合约的去中心化特性符合人们对于信任和安全交易的需求,因此在各行业的潜力巨大。随着技术的发展和法律框架的完善,智能合约的普及程度将不断提高。

                  综上所述,区块链合约方式,即智能合约,不仅是技术的发展成果,更是商业模式创新的重要推动力。虽然目前仍面临一些挑战,但其巨大的应用潜力和市场需求,使得区块链合约方式成为值得探索的方向。随着技术的成熟和法律的完善,未来智能合约将在更多领域中得到广泛应用,推动社会的进一步发展。

                  分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                              相关新闻

                              如何安全管理比特币在线
                              2025-01-27
                              如何安全管理比特币在线

                              随着比特币和其他加密货币的普及,越来越多的人开始使用在线钱包来存储和管理他们的数字资产。然而,安全管理...

                              区块链彩票是什么意思区
                              2025-03-28
                              区块链彩票是什么意思区

                              随着科技的迅猛发展,尤其是区块链技术的普及,彩票行业也受到了一定程度的变革。区块链彩票作为这一变革的重...

                              冷钱包详解:什么是冷钱
                              2025-03-22
                              冷钱包详解:什么是冷钱

                              一、冷钱包的定义 冷钱包是指一种不连接互联网的数字货币存储方式。它主要用于安全保存各种加密货币。相比于热...

                              MetaMask提现是否需要审核?
                              2024-12-29
                              MetaMask提现是否需要审核?

                              MetaMask作为一个广受欢迎的以太坊和ERC-20代币的数字钱包,不仅允许用户存储和管理他们的加密货币资产,还提供与去...

                                                            标签